Aston University offers master's scholarships for the students of Argentina, Colombia, Salvador, Jamaica, Belize, Costa Rica, Guatemala, Mexico, Bolivia, Cuba, Guyana, Nicaragua, Brazil, Dominican Republic, Haiti, Panama, Chile, Ecuador, Honduras, Paraguay, Peru, Puerto Rico, Surinam, Uruguay, USA and Venezuela. Three £5,000 scholarships are available for successful applicants entering any postgraduate full-time taught master's programmes (including the MBA programme) at Aston University. Applicants must hold a conditional or unconditional offer for a postgraduate full-time taught Master's programme commencing at Aston University in September 2013. Application should be submitted till 31st May 2013.

Eligibility: -If the applicant is currently completing their undergraduate Bachelors degree in another country (for example: UK, Canada, Australia), this scholarship is still open, provided the applicant is a national of, and is ordinarily resident in, one of the above named countries and is a full . -Priority will be given to applicants who have graduated or will be graduating from one of the partner universities within the Santander Universities network. -Applicants must hold a conditional or unconditional offer for a postgraduate full-time taught Masters programme commencing at Aston University in September 2013. -Applicants must hold a strong academic record, having been awarded or expected to complete with the equivalent of: -A minimum 2.1 / Upper Second classification in their undergraduate Bachelors degree in the UK. -A minimum GPA of 3.0 (out of 4.0) in their undergraduate Bachelors degree from a overseas institution. -Applicants with an existing UK postgraduate qualification will not be eligible. -Applicants must also submit the following: -An application in the form of a 500 word essay outlining why they would benefit from the scholarship and the difference it would make to them as well as why they would be a suitable person to work with the International Office to share their experiences at the University and help promote Aston to future students. -Scanned copy of your passport showing your nationality. -Applicants must not be in receipt of a full fee scholarship from any other source. However, applicants may be eligible to apply for another partial tuition fee scholarship offered by Aston University. -Applicants must be deemed self-financing non-EU full overseas fee payers

Terms and conditions: The successful scholars will be required to sign an agreement with the Aston University International Office to share their experiences of application, arrival, studying at Aston, lecturers and lectures, and student life. They will work with the International Office to provide information which can be used for promotional purposes, as well as regularly update a blog, which has to be created from the beginning of an academic year at Aston. The work will be used across the University including the School of study and the Development & Alumni Relations office.
